Hoffman’s FS66S series free-stand enclosures are a prime example of the type of solutions that Hoffman provides. The FS66S free-stand enclosures are designed to house large components such as motor starters and PLCs as well as other electronic and electrical equipment.

FS66S Global Free-Stand Type 4X Enclosure Specifications:

  • Internal grid mounting system compatible with Hoffman’s PROLINE enclosure mounting system
  • Enclosure supports evenly distributed content for Standard duty 500Kg (1102 lb.) and Heavy duty 1000Kg (2205 lb.).
  • Uni-body design with seams continuously welded and ground smooth
  • Seamless foam-in-place gasket assures a water-tight and dust-tight seal
  • Body flange trough collar channels liquids and contaminants away from door opening and installed equipment
  • Removable hidden hinges
  • Built-in plinth base that allows for flexible cable entry
  • Painted or galvanized back panels can be rear-mounted in single-access enclosures and back-to-back in dual access enclosures
